I always taught and demonstrated practice pans on 121.5 to my students (I also insisted that they declared themselves as "LOST" not "temporarily uncertain of position" what a mouthful and frankly a load of b****x). Shortly after going over the procedure with a colleague's student, I had the pleasure of hearing that student using it for real on a solo nav. As you'd expect D&D handled it with utmost professionalism and I listened in while teaching practice autorotations to my student. Also listening in was the local police unit who I could see hovering nearby and offered his assistance. Eventually the lost pilot reported visual with the destination. At this point the police unit piped up, reporting that he thought he was visual with the lost aircraft, and that he couldn't be visual - the airfield was behind him. D&D asked the lost pilot to confirm he was visual with the airfield, which he did and requested change to XXXX. I could not resist telling the police pilot (on 121.5) that I believed he was looking at me. I did however restrain from asking why he thought that a lost pilot would be doing practice autorotations.
